- [ ] **Step 7: Breaker override escrow.** After sealing the signing keys for the Tallgrove upstream API circuit breaker, confirm the support team can force the breaker open during a full outage. The override bundle lives in the sealed escrow drawer and is useless without its unlock phrase. Two ceremony witnesses must initial this step before proceeding. The escrow bundle is decrypted with the recovery passphrase that follows.

vault phrase of kahip-kahop = holath-quenmir

## Runbook: Pebblekiosk Watchdog

The watchdog restarts the kiosk app if the heartbeat stops for 30 seconds. Three restarts in ten minutes triggers safe mode and a support alert. Do not disable the watchdog on live units; use maintenance mode instead. To check status, open the service panel on the device and confirm the heartbeat counter is incrementing. If a unit loops in safe mode, collect logs before rebooting. The watchdog reads its settings at startup; the current values are below.

settings of tagef-bawif:
DRUIX_HOST=druix.zemvarlabs.internal
DRUIX_PORT=8000

## The Watchdog (a.k.a. "Barky")

Every Pavilion kiosk runs a small watchdog process that pings the main app every 20 seconds and hard-restarts it after three misses. It's saved us from countless frozen touchscreens at the Oakhollow transit hubs, so please don't disable it, even "temporarily." Barky also reports restart events to the internal Kennel telemetry service so we can spot flaky units before riders complain. To let it talk to Kennel, drop the key below into /etc/barky/creds before first boot.

service key, fawip-bajef: kto11_Qt5wZK9vdNC

Subject: Quickstore 4.2 — bloom filter now fronts the KV layer

Plugin authors: starting with this release, Quickstore places a bloom filter ahead of the key-value store. Negative lookups return faster; false positives fall through safely. No API changes are required on your side. Verify your plugin against the staging build referenced below.

session token of fahif-tadup = htk3_9c7